International Chess Player woman FIDE Masters, Tanishka Kotia and her sister Riddhika Kotia are appointed as Brand Ambassadors of ‘Beti Bachao Beti Padhao’ scheme for the Gurugram District of Haryana. Tanishka Kotia won the Limca Book of Records for being the youngest chess player in 2008. They belong to the Haryana state.

Tanishka Kotia ranks 2nd in the country in the under-16 category, World Chess Federation rankings released in 2019. She won a gold medal at the ASEAN Chess Championship in 2013 and silver at the Commonwealth Chess Championship In 2014 in Scotland. Riddhika Kotia represented India at several prestigious international events, including the World Junior Chess Championship 2020.
